Washington Wizards vs Indiana Pacers Preview and Analysis

 
The Wizards finished last season with a 35-47 record overall and they were 14-27 in their road games where they will be in this game. They finished in 4th place of the Southeast Division and were 12th place overall in the Eastern Conference. They did not make it to the playoffs last season. Their offense averaged 108.6 PPG and their defense allowed their opponents to average 112 PPG against them. The Wizards had an ATS record of 33-47-2 last season and their O/U record is 44-37-1. They lost 3 of their 4 preseason games and ended it off with a loss against the New York Knicks.
 
 
 
The Pacers finished last season with a 25-57 record overall and they were 16-25 in their home games where they will be in this game. They finished in 4th place of the Central Division and were 13th place overall in the Eastern Conference. They did not make it to the playoffs last season. Their offense averaged 111.5 PPG and their defense allowed their opponents to average 114.9 PPG against them. The Pacers had an ATS record of 38-42-2 last season and their O/U record is 47-34-1. They lost 2 of their last 3 games to end their preseason and they ended it off with a loss against the Houston Rockets.

 

Wizards vs Pacers Prediction

The current betting odds have the Wizards listed as a 2.5 point favorite in this game according to Draftkings Sportsbook. The Wizards just had a very disappointing season where they missed out on the playoffs but almost made it into a play-in game. They have a good core group of guys on their team but they had their moments in games last season and just could not get it done, even blowing some really big leads in a lot of their games. They were a mess all season but started to get things together a bit near the end of the year after acquiring a few new pieces via trade. They have a solid defensive piece in Porzingis now that he is healthy again and Beal was running over teams along with Kuzma when they were getting hot. The Pacers traded away a lot of their talent and are left with a very young team that is going to need to develop more. They have some good players but it is not enough to put together a strong season and there will likely be a lot of growing pains as this team continues to rebuild. The Wizards have more talent and will be looking to get off to a hot start after the way their season went last year.
